Here, the cycle path crosses the watershed between the Leine and Unstrut rivers. To the north, the water flows via the Leine, Aller, and Weser rivers into the North Sea. There, it also meets the water that flows southward via the Unstrut, Saale, and Elbe into the North Sea.

The Ars Natura artwork stands at the parking lot of the same name (Hand). Its name probably comes from the many paths that converge here in a star shape.

Around Effelder, you can find various types of shelters, including refuges, cottages, and bivouac stations. These structures are designed to provide shelter and resting points along the hiking trails, catering to different needs from a quick break to a potential overnight stay.
Visitors highly recommend several spots. The Schimberg Cross at Martinfeld Window is praised for its refuge, wooden cross, benches, and excellent views of Martinfeld. The Swiss Cottage in the Küllstedt Valley is a favorite for its forest setting, fire pit, and camping platforms. The Elbe–Weser Watershed is also popular for its beautiful plateau and break opportunities.
Yes, several huts and resting points provide scenic views. The Schimberg Cross at Martinfeld Window offers a great view of Martinfeld. The Elbe–Weser Watershed is a plateau known for its beautiful views. Additionally, the Wooden Hand Sculpture (Ars Natura) is near a viewpoint on a high plateau above Treffurt.
Many of the huts and resting places around Effelder are considered family-friendly. For example, the Schimberg Cross at Martinfeld Window, the Swiss Cottage in the Küllstedt Valley, and the Bivouac Station Küllstedter Grund are all categorized as family-friendly, offering comfortable spots for breaks during family outings.
The region around Effelder is rich in natural features. You can visit the Elbe–Weser Watershed, a natural monument marking the divide between two major river systems. Many huts, like the Swiss Cottage in the Küllstedt Valley, are nestled within forests, offering a chance to experience the local woodland environment.

Some huts offer facilities for overnight stays or camping. For instance, the Swiss Cottage in the Küllstedt Valley features platforms for camping and a fire pit. For specific details on permits or availability for overnight stays, it's advisable to inquire with the local administrative community, such as the Westerwald administrative community in Küllstedt for the Swiss Cottage.
